Output eff4b8d990d8b9908e809143b640a33f2662449ebfeacc6b2c39c4922c74c949:0

value
40959058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d0d72e3fc21ea0436f494a9ca21bb40e413bc46 OP_EQUAL
address
35oEScbWJovJJBsdiyBkmYYaAyDQWBvdHW
transaction
eff4b8d990d8b9908e809143b640a33f2662449ebfeacc6b2c39c4922c74c949
spent
true